Lolz... I see fashion as a very personal thing... and to me, it may look a tad to long and baggy, but you may like it that way. 
 
In the beginning of my fashion discovery way... I bought so many ill-fitted jackets... and you don't know that until you have bought a few that fits good... now, now matter how much a love the color, material or style, if it doesn't fit my body right, I won't buy it.  I like a "rich" classic look... so if the clothes I am trying on don't impart that feel, I don't buy it.
 
One thing I notice about you is that you THINK you have junk in the middle so you tend to wear loose clothing that "hides" that.  You are actually quite trim... way skinnier than me... you should wear clothing that are more fitted or body skimming... the trick is the material and cut... and higher end clothing line...
 
The lower clothing line... although the clothes look the same as the higher end on the  hangers... it fits the body totally differently.  Lower end clothing cuts and squeeze the body in the wrong places... while the higher end clothing line skims over the trouble spot and creates a nice trim shape.
